div.impressum{
	margin-top: 0px;
	padding-top: 0px;
	padding-left: 28px;
}

	div.impressum div.left {
		width: 284px;
		float: left;
		padding-bottom: 20px;
	}
	
		div.impressum div.left h2 {
			background-color: #DB0006;
			color: #fff;
			
			font-size: 12px;

			height: 37px;
			padding: 0px;
			padding-top: 7px;
			padding-left: 16px;
			
			margin: 0px;
		}
		
		div.impressum div.left ul {
			margin: 0px;
			padding: 0px;
			list-style: none;
		}
		
			div.impressum div.left ul li{
				margin: 0px;
				padding: 18px 0px 8px 0px;
				overflow: hidden; 
			}
		
			div.impressum div.left ul li.odd{
				background-color: #6C8089;				
			}
		
			div.impressum div.left ul li.even{
				background-color: #35484F;
			}
			
				div.impressum div.left ul li h3{
					float: left;
					margin: 0px;
					
					padding: 0px;
					padding-top: 15px;
					padding-right: 10px;
					
					width: 83px;
					height: 55px;
					
					letter-spacing:-0.08em;
					font-size: 12px;
					text-align: right;
					
					color: #fff;
				}
				
				div.impressum div.left ul li.odd h3{
					background-color: #AD0004;
				}
				
				div.impressum div.left ul li.even h3{
					background-color: #DB0006;
				}
			
				div.impressum div.left ul li p{
					float: left;
					width: 165px;
					padding: 0px 13px;
					margin: 0px;
					color: #fff;
				}
		
	

	div.impressum div.center {
		margin-left: 21px;
		width: 285px;
		float: left;
	}
	
		div.impressum div.center h2 {
			background-color: #DB0006;
			
			color: #fff;
			font-size: 12px;
			
			
			height: 20px;
			padding-top: 13px;
			padding-left: 16px;
			
			margin: 0px;
			margin-bottom: 6px;
		}
	
		div.impressum div.center div.content {
			border: 1px solid #fff;
			background-color: #F3EFEE;
			padding: 13px 21px;
		}
		
			div.impressum div.center div.content p{
				margin: 0px;
				padding: 0px;
				margin-top: 16px;
			}

	div.impressum div.right {
		margin-left: 21px;
		width: 285px;
		float: left;
	}
	
	
		div.impressum div.right h2 {
			
			color: #fff;
			font-size: 12px;
			
			
			height: 20px;
			padding-top: 13px;
			padding-left: 16px;
			
			margin: 0px;
			margin-bottom: 6px;
		}
		div.impressum div.right .odd h2 {
			background-color: #AD0004;
		
		}
		div.impressum div.right .even h2 {
			background-color: #DB0006;
		}
	
		div.impressum div.right div.content {
			border: 1px solid #fff;
			padding: 13px 21px;
		
		}
		div.impressum div.right div.odd div.content {
			margin-bottom: 23px;
		}
		
		div.impressum div.right .odd div.content {
			background-color: #E9DFDE;
		}
		
		div.impressum div.right .even div.content {
			background-color: #F3EFEE;
		}
		
			div.impressum div.right div.content img{
				float: right;
			}
		
			div.impressum div.right div.content p{
				margin: 0px;
				padding: 0px;
				margin-bottom: 16px;
			}
			
			div.impressum div.right div.content p.title{
				margin-bottom: 0px;
				color: #DB0006;
				font-weight: bold;
			}